Tengo un informe params aspx page donde estoy completando todos los parámetros que utilizaré más adelante para generar el informe.
Cuando el usuario pulsa el botón "Mostrar informe", abro otra página aspx donde tengo un objeto ReportDocument repDoc
para generar el informe. Para representar el informe i utilizar el siguiente código:Cómo anular un informe de Crystal
repDoc.ExportToHttpResponse(ExportFormatType.PortableDocFormat, Response, false, "Report Name");
Hay informes que toman tiempo y algunos usuarios prefieren para cerrar la página, pero aún así se genera el informe en el servidor. ¿Cómo puedo cancelar el informe después de haber llamado al método ExportToHttpResponse
para evitar generar informes que nadie verá ni usará?